When creating a detailed brief for orthographic vs isometric experts, it is essential to first understand the differences between the two. Orthographic drawings are a set of two-dimensional drawings that represent a three-dimensional object, while isometric drawings provide a three-dimensional representation of an object in a two-dimensional format.
To create a detailed brief for orthographic experts, start by clearly defining the project requirements and objectives. This includes specifying the dimensions, angles, and views that need to be represented in the drawings. Provide any relevant sketches, photos, or reference materials to help the expert understand your vision.
For isometric experts, focus on detailing the specific angles and perspectives you want to be included in the drawings. Communicate the desired level of detail, shading, and scale for the isometric renderings to ensure the final product meets your expectations.
